Barton County
Barton County has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$58,851. Population has declined 11% since 2000. 22%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 36%.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$126,400.

How many people live in Barton County, Kansas?
Barton County, Kansas has about 25,097 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Barton County, Kansas?
The typical household in Barton County, Kansas earns about $58,851 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Barton County, Kansas expensive?
In Barton County, Kansas, the median home is worth about $126,400, and the typical rent is about $761 a month.
How educated are people in Barton County, Kansas?
About 21.7% of adults age 25 and over in Barton County, Kansas h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Barton County, Kansas?
About 15.4% of people in Barton County, Kansas live below the federal poverty line.
